**14:22 — Locker access flow degraded.** The Tumblegate API began rejecting plugin-issued unlock requests for the Fernside laundry lockers. Plugin authors saw generic 409 responses rather than the documented retry hint, so most clients looped. Root cause was a stale capability cache on the gateway shard serving the Brindlemoor region. Mitigation: cache flush at 14:41, full recovery by 14:50. If your plugin logged failures in this window, correlate against the trace token noted below.

pipeline stamp: htk9_6ce9d33c5

## Step 3: Enable offline mode

FieldNote 5 now caches survey responses locally and syncs when connectivity returns. Plugins must declare offline-safe operations in their manifest; anything undeclared is blocked while offline. Test with the built-in airplane simulator before publishing. To activate the offline layer, set these values in your plugin runtime.

service settings:
[casax]
port = 6379
team = rusir
host = casax.zemvarhq.corp
region = outer-4
access_code = ac_9808ce
timeout_ms = 1500

## Releases

Toggleweir releases are cut weekly from main. Artifacts are built by the Harrowby pipeline, signed, and pushed to the internal registry. On-call: verify the signature before promoting any rollout bundle to production. Unsigned or mismatched bundles must be rejected and the build re-run. Verification requires the current release signing key, which is listed below.

deploy key for tahof-yadup: bky6_JWeaJq

- [ ] **Step 7: Breaker override escrow.** After sealing the signing keys for the Tallgrove upstream API circuit breaker, confirm the support team can force the breaker open during a full outage. The override bundle lives in the sealed escrow drawer and is useless without its unlock phrase. Two ceremony witnesses must initial this step before proceeding. The escrow bundle is decrypted with the recovery passphrase that follows.

vault phrase of kahip-kahop = holath-quenmir

## Build Provenance: Autocomplete Index

Plugin authors integrating with the Thistledown editor should note that the slow autocomplete reported last quarter stemmed from an unsigned index artifact rebuilt nightly on the Copperfen farm. All index builds are now attested and reproducible; plugins must verify provenance before loading a local index. The currently attested index build is recorded below.

pipeline stamp: htk31_0320b403a7d85d795607a9e75b13f71